Market Context

Trading volume for BOOT has been in line with its 30-day average in recent sessions, with no unusual spikes or declines indicating abnormal market interest in the stock. The broader specialty retail sector, where Boot Barn operates, has seen choppy performance this month as market participants weigh incoming data on consumer confidence and household disposable income, key drivers of spending on discretionary goods like the western wear, work boots, and lifestyle products sold by BOOT. Analysts estimate that discretionary retail names may continue to see elevated volatility as markets adjust to evolving macroeconomic expectations, with no clear directional trend for the sector emerging in recent weeks. There are no announced company-specific events on BOOT’s public calendar for the immediate short term, according to available market data, so near-term price action is expected to remain tied to both broader sector moves and technical levels. Technical Analysis

BOOT is currently trading near the midpoint of its established near-term trading range, between identified support at $144.88 and resistance at $160.14. The $144.88 support level has acted as a reliable floor for the stock in recent weeks, with buyers stepping in to limit pullbacks each time the stock has tested that price point, indicating consistent demand at that level. The $160.14 resistance level, meanwhile, has capped upward moves on multiple recent occasions, with sellers entering the market to push prices lower each time BOOT has approached that threshold. Momentum indicators for the stock are currently neutral, with its 14-day relative strength index (RSI) in the mid-40s, showing no signs of extreme overbought or oversold conditions that would signal an imminent sharp move. BOOT is also trading roughly in line with its short-term moving averages, while longer-term moving averages remain in a gentle uptrend, suggesting that the stock’s longer-term price structure may still lean positive, even as near-term price action stays range-bound. Outlook

Market participants monitoring BOOT may want to watch for tests of the key support and resistance levels in upcoming sessions. A break above the $160.14 resistance level on higher-than-average volume could signal that near-term bullish momentum is building, potentially leading to an expansion of the stock’s trading range to the upside. Conversely, a break below the $144.88 support level on elevated volume might indicate that selling pressure is intensifying, which could lead to a near-term retracement for the stock. Because BOOT has no upcoming company-specific news scheduled as of this analysis, broader macroeconomic data releases and sector flows could also influence the stock’s ability to hold support or break through resistance in the coming weeks. Low-volume tests of either technical level would likely be seen as less reliable signals of a sustained shift in price direction, based on common technical analysis frameworks.
